Alkaloids of the roots of Desmodium gangeticum

Abstract: Previously, the occurrence of several simple indolic bases in the aerial portions of Desmodium gangeticum D.C. (Leguminosae : Papilionaceae) was reported by us.lSince the roots of this species find use in the ayurvedic system of medicine,= we have now investigated their alkaloidal constituents. The present communication describes the isolation and identification of seven alkaloids representing three structural types, viz. carboxylated and decarboxylated tryptamines, and ,B-phenylethylamine. “…These reactions, catalyzed by the aromatic amino acid decarboxylase (E.C.4.1.1.28), are commonly the first step in the biosynthesis of many important alkaloids (Berlin and Fecker, 2000;Facchini and DeLuca, 1995;Gu¨gler et al, 1988;Marques and Brodelius, 1988). b-Phenethylamine (b-PHA), the decarboxylated form of phenylalanine, has formerly been reported as the usual component of alkaloids in cactus (Keller et al, 1973;Mata and McLaughlin, 1980) and in perennial legume trees such as Alhagi pseudalhagi , Prosopis nigra (Moro et al, 1975), and many species of Desmodium (Ghosal and Banerjee, 1969;Ghosal et al, 1972;Ghosal and Mehta, 1974) and Acacia (Camp and Norvell, 1966;Fitzgerald, 1964). Tissue extracts of these plant species generally contain a variety of b-PHA derivatives (e.g., mescaline, N-methyl-b-PHA, and hordenine), often referred to as PHA alkaloids, which show sympatho-mimetic properties, psychic effects, and other versatile pharmacological actions on higher animals Kapadia and Fayez, 1970;Smith, 1977a).…”

“…Total alkaloids of this species showed smooth muscle stimulant, anticholinesterase, CNS stimulant and depressant responses (Ghosal and Bhattacharya, 1972). Chemical investigations have revealed that this plant contains alkaloids like tryptamines, phenethylamines, and their N-oxides (Ghosal and Banerjee, 1969); pterocarpanoids like gangetin, gangetinin, desmodin, and desmocarpin (Purushotaman et al, 1971(Purushotaman et al, , 1975Ingham and Dewick, 1984); phospholipids (Rastogi et al, 1971), sterols such as 24-ethylcholesta-5, 22-diene-3␤-ol; 24-ethylcholest-5-en-3␤-ol and 24-methylcholest-5-en-3␤-ol (Mukat and Varshney, 1986), flavone glycosides such as 4 ,5,7-trihydroxy-8-prenylflavone-4 -O-␣-l-rhamnopyranosyl-(1-6)-␤-d-glucopyranoside and 8-C-prenyl-5,7,5 -trimethoxy-3 ,4 -methylenedioxy flavone (Yadava and Reddy, 1998;Yadava and Tripathi, 1998).…”
